As a Logistics Planning Support Technician, you will support the coordination and improvement of logistics planning activities across Building Construction Products, Leicester, with a key focus on Fleet operations. You will work in a fast‑paced environment, managing high‑volume data and invoice activity, ensuring processes are accurate, efficient, and aligned to Caterpillar Production System (CPS) principles.
What You Will Do
- Support the development and improvement of logistics processes to enhance safety, efficiency, and consistency.
- Manage and analyse high‑volume data and invoices, ensuring accuracy, identifying discrepancies, and minimising financial and business risk.
- Support Continuous Improvement (CI) activities, resolving day‑to‑day issues and driving practical, sustainable improvements with the logistics fleet department.
- Work across teams to support logistics planning and Fleet activity, managing competing priorities in a fast‑paced environment e.g. breakdowns, servicing, invoicing and quotations.
- Create, update, and audit Standard Work documentation in line with CPS and CQMS standards.

Benefits
- 27 days annual leave + bank holidays, opportunity to buy additional holiday.
- Bonus Contributory pension scheme – Caterpillar will double the employee's contribution up to 10%.
- Contributory share scheme – Caterpillar will match 50% of the employee's contribution.
- Employee Support Networks – join groups that offer support, connection, and a sense of community.
- Optional flexible benefits including access to private health and dental care plans, EV car lease, etc.
